Transaction 8ab5a5aec6962aafca12ef9dbfb35dee4864cc8fae1ff47edac48867d893ec7e
1 Input
1 Output
-
8ab5a5aec6962aafca12ef9dbfb35dee4864cc8fae1ff47edac48867d893ec7e:0
- value
- 62020080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ba33dae63d11035e6e091cfea132ea7a4bb437c OP_EQUAL
- address
- 38axA7N7whc47TRt879z3ysTFDaEKXFcbt